But here is the way you do it.
Here is a simple shell script that will do it. If you aren't familiar with shell scripts, I'd google it. But I will try to explain.
You will open a text editor like kwrite or gedit, and put the code in, replace YOURUSERHERE with your username. Also edit the location as it reflects where you have the client folder:
Code:
#!/bin/sh
cd /home/YOURUSERHERE/TeamSpeak3-Client-linux_x86/
./ts3client_runscript.sh
When you save it, you need to make sure to call it something like TameSpeak3 or TeamSpeak3.sh... either will do.
Now you need to give it permission to run, so go to you console and go to the directory where you put the file and type this:
Code:
chmod 755 TeamSpeak3
if you put the .sh at the end, put that in that line as well. now when you double click the shellscript, it should bring up TS3 without the console/terminal.
